These are the Bible verses most often cited for jealousy and envy, ranked by the OpenBible.info topical community across 17,228 votes, led by James 3:14-16. Each passage links to its verse page or the interactive map; scripture is the King James Version.
Top verses about Jealousy and Envy
James 3:14-161,448 votes
But if ye have bitter envying and strife in your hearts, glory not, and lie not against the truth.
Proverbs 14:301,173 votes
A sound heart is the life of the flesh: but envy the rottenness of the bones.
1 Corinthians 13:4779 votes
Charity suffereth long, and is kind; charity envieth not; charity vaunteth not itself, is not puffed up,
Proverbs 27:4720 votes
Wrath is cruel, and anger is outrageous; but who is able to stand before envy?
Galatians 5:19-21692 votes
Now the works of the flesh are manifest, which are these; Adultery, fornication, uncleanness, lasciviousness,
Philippians 2:3678 votes
Let nothing be done through strife or vainglory; but in lowliness of mind let each esteem other better than themselves.
James 3:16672 votes
For where envying and strife is, there is confusion and every evil work.
1 Corinthians 3:3546 votes
For ye are yet carnal: for whereas there is among you envying, and strife, and divisions, are ye not carnal, and walk as men?
Romans 13:13424 votes
Let us walk honestly, as in the day; not in rioting and drunkenness, not in chambering and wantonness, not in strife and envying.
1 Corinthians 13:1-13318 votes
Though I speak with the tongues of men and of angels, and have not charity, I am become as sounding brass, or a tinkling cymbal.
Song of Songs 8:6306 votes
Set me as a seal upon thine heart, as a seal upon thine arm: for love is strong as death; jealousy is cruel as the grave: the coals thereof are coals of fire, which hath a most vehement flame.
Ecclesiastes 4:4304 votes
Again, I considered all travail, and every right work, that for this a man is envied of his neighbour. This is also vanity and vexation of spirit.
1 John 4:8296 votes
He that loveth not knoweth not God; for God is love.
Job 5:2235 votes
For wrath killeth the foolish man, and envy slayeth the silly one.
Acts 7:9212 votes
And the patriarchs, moved with envy, sold Joseph into Egypt: but God was with him,
Psalms 37:1199 votes
Fret not thyself because of evildoers, neither be thou envious against the workers of iniquity.
James 4:7196 votes
Submit yourselves therefore to God. Resist the devil, and he will flee from you.
Titus 3:3193 votes
For we ourselves also were sometimes foolish, disobedient, deceived, serving divers lusts and pleasures, living in malice and envy, hateful, and hating one another.
1 Peter 2:1174 votes
Wherefore laying aside all malice, and all guile, and hypocrisies, and envies, and all evil speakings,
John 8:32170 votes
And ye shall know the truth, and the truth shall make you free.
Proverbs 23:17168 votes
Let not thine heart envy sinners: but be thou in the fear of the Lord all the day long.
1 Peter 4:8167 votes
And above all things have fervent charity among yourselves: for charity shall cover the multitude of sins.
Exodus 20:17164 votes
Thou shalt not covet thy neighbour’s house, thou shalt not covet thy neighbour’s wife, nor his manservant, nor his maidservant, nor his ox, nor his ass, nor any thing that is thy neighbour’s.
Proverbs 6:34146 votes
For jealousy is the rage of a man: therefore he will not spare in the day of vengeance.
Deuteronomy 4:24140 votes
For the Lord thy God is a consuming fire, even a jealous God.
